That's a common problem on the 97-99 Camrys. The strut plate is the top part of the strut assembly. You have to remove the strut assembly form the car and compress the spring and then take the assembly apart to remove the uppper strut plate. You will need a manual to show you how to do this. If you don't have one, you can download a Toyota factory service manual for free at the top of the Camry forum over at AutomotiveForums.com. Download the generation 4 manual. The procedure will be in the suspension section.
